Git

git 커밋 삭제하기

189bigman 2023. 2. 2. 00:03

 

현재 커밋을 확인

 

제일 최신(마지막에 커밋한) 커밋을 삭제하고 변경 내역을 남기고 싶을때

 

git reset --soft HEAD~1

 

결과

커밋은 삭제됐고 변경내역은 남아있다.

 

다시 커밋을 한 상황

제일 최신(마지막에 커밋한) 커밋을 삭제하고 변경 내역도 지울때

 

git reset --hard HEAD~1

커밋 내역도 사라지고 커밋 작업분도 삭제됐다.